The Holy Father's invitation in his Apostolic Letter, Misericordia et misera, asks parishes to offer 24 Hours for the Lord on the Friday and Saturday before the Fourth Sunday of Lent.
Our Lady of Grace Church will be open for a period of (more than) 24 hours from Friday, March 12 (starting after daily Mass concludes, approx. 9:00 AM) to Saturday, March 13 (ending just before the Vigil Mass, 4:00 PM). The faithful are encouraged to encounter the mercy of the Lord in Adoration of the Most Blessed Sacrament during these (more than) 24 hours.
For those that can't make it in person, we will be live-streaming a holy hour on both Friday and Saturday. We will live-stream the 8:00 AM daily Mass on both days (as usual), and we'll leave the stream going until 10:00 AM, so that those who tune in can also participate in (virtual) Adoration.
